Description

2-(3-Chloro-2-Methoxyphenyl)-4,4,5,5-tetramethyl-1,3,2-dioxaborolane is a high-purity boronic ester derivative, serving as a critical synthetic intermediate in modern organic chemistry. Its value lies in enabling efficient, palladium-catalyzed cross-coupling reactions, such as the Suzuki-Miyaura reaction, which is fundamental for constructing complex carbon-carbon bonds. This compound is essential for researchers and manufacturers in the pharmaceutical, agrochemical, and advanced materials sectors who require reliable, high-quality building blocks for drug discovery and specialty chemical synthesis.

Basic Information

Product Name 2-(3-Chloro-2-Methoxyphenyl)-4,4,5,5-Tetramethyl-1,3,2-Dioxaborolane
CAS No. 1628502-45-3
Molecular Formula C13H18BClO3
Molecular Weight 268.54 g/mol
Synonyms (3-Chloro-2-methoxyphenyl)boronic acid pinacol ester; 2-(3-Chloro-2-methoxyphenyl)-4,4,5,5-tetramethyl-1,3,2-dioxaborolane; 3-Chloro-2-methoxybenzeneboronic acid pinacol ester; Pinacol (3-chloro-2-methoxyphenyl)boronate; (3-Chloro-2-methoxyphenyl)pinacolboronate; B-(3-Chloro-2-methoxyphenyl)-4,4,5,5-tetramethyl-1,3,2-dioxaborolane; CAS 1628502-45-3

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Keep the container tightly sealed under an inert atmosphere to prevent moisture absorption and degradation. Keep away from heat, sparks, and open flame.
